> We have a requirement to consume the oldest stable files first from an SFTP
> server using maxMessagesPerPoll=10. We found that the two available
> configurations both have trade-offs:
> * eagerMaxMessagesPerPoll=false + sortBy=file:modified — achieves
> oldest-first correctly, but creates Exchange/GenericFileMessage objects for
> every file on the server before sorting, which doesn't scale with large
> directories.
> * eagerMaxMessagesPerPoll=true (default) + sortBy=file:modified — limits to
> 10 files before sorting, breaking the oldest-first guarantee.
> To achieve sort-before-limit without the memory overhead, we extended
> SftpOperations.listFiles() to sort the raw SftpRemoteFile[] array by mtime
> ascending immediately after channel.ls() — before any RemoteFile,
> DefaultExchange, or GenericFileMessage objects are created. The full approach
> with CustomSortedSftpComponent, CustomSortedSftpEndpoint, and
> CustomSortedSftpOperations is documented in the Stack Overflow question
> below, along with the two questions we're looking to get community input on.
